Does anyone know how to change the forecolor (fontcolor) of the datetime picker. I can amend the colors of the popup calendar, but not the actual combo where the text is displayed.

Any Ideas?

Steve
 
I don't think you can Steve - a few months ago I developed some data-entry custom controls that would change colour if the value entered was invalid in some way (e.g. out of range). One of them used a DateTimePicker and I remember that I had to leave it so the user had to drop down the calendar to see if it had changed colour - I'm pretty sure (although this is from memory, so I could be mistaken) that there was no easy way to change the combo's font colour (or background colour, for that matter). Of course, there might be a way to do it with some fiendishly clever use of API calls, but I don't think I looked into that...
